City - Welland

The gentle flow of the canal through Welland sets the pace of life in the city. Enjoy the greenery surrounding the canal as you walk the trails that follow the length of it. Bridge 13 stands as the symbol of Downtown Welland and is a well-known landmark of the city. Shops sit along East Main Street, next to Bridge 13, so you always know where you are as you walk between local boutiques and restaurants. In this neighbourhood, you’ll find your coffee fix, the bustling farmers’ market in Market Square, and the public library steps from Civic Square. The long green strip next to the canal at Merritt Island Park calls you to unwind with a stroll or a paddle.

What everyday life looks like across Welland may differ slightly depending on the neighbourhood, but the energy of the people and city is always welcoming. The old canal weaves through many corners, serving as a recreational spine whether you're downtown or in the surrounding neighbourhoods.
